Maintenance Tips of MG 90006314 Screw for MG5/MG GT/MG6
- First, when replacing the MG Screw (OE# 90006314) for MG5, MG GT, or MG6 models, make sure to use a suitable screwdriver to avoid stripping the screw head.
- Secondly, check the screw's length and thread pitch to ensure it matches the original specification. Using an incorrect screw may lead to loose connections.
- Thirdly, clean the screw hole before installing the new screw. Debris in the hole can affect the screw's tightness.
- Fourthly, apply a small amount of anti - seize compound on the screw threads for better corrosion resistance, especially in harsh environments.
- Finally, tighten the screw to the recommended torque. Over - tightening can damage the parts, while under - tightening may cause the screw to come loose.
